CRITTENDEN COUNTY, Ark.(localmemphis.com) – Homes and yards are prone to flooding during the summermonths, so the Crittenden County Road Department is offering free sandbags toprevent flooding.

D.C. Armstrong is anemployee for the road department and said there have been families who willbarricade their homes with sandbags to prevent flooding.

“Because of all therain we had this spring and summer, it’s just an unusual amount of water andthe people that have needed the bags have been flooded two or threetimes,” Armstrong said.

Crittenden County JudgeWoody Wheeless said on Facebook that the all people need to bring is a shoveland the road department will provide the sand and bags.

Armstrong said some peopletook 45 to 60 sandbags home with them to cover their garage doors and doors totheir homes.

The road department willbe offering the free sandbags throughout the rest of the season for anyone whoneeds them.
